Original Orientation When copying double-sided documents or making double-sided copies or combined copies,
specify the document orientation; otherwise, the copies may not be printed in the correct
page order or correct front and back page arrangement.
Upright Images: Select this setting for an original document loaded with the top toward
the back of the printer.
Sideways Images: Select this setting for an original document loaded into the
document feeder with the top of the original document toward the left side of the
printer or an original document placed on the scanner glass with the top of the original
document toward the right side of the printer.
Original Type The original type setting is used to improve copy quality by selecting document types for
current copy jobs.
Text: Use for originals containing mostly text.
Text/Photo: Use for originals containing text mixed with photographs.
Photo: Use when the originals are photographs.
Copied Original: Use for copied documents.
Map: Use for maps.
Light Original: Use for light documents.
N-Up Reduces the size of the original images and prints 2 or 32 pages onto one sheet of paper.
O: Copies an original onto one sheet of paper.
2UP - 32UP: Copies corresponding numbers of separate originals to one page.
NOTE: Depending on original document size, output paper size, and the reduced rate of
image, some options may be inactivated.
